Tools for Efficient Keyword Discovery
Uncovering the right keywords is a cornerstone of successful SEO strategies. Start by leveraging powerful keyword research tools like Google Ads Keyword Planner, Ahrefs, SEMrush, or Moz Keyword Explorer. These tools provide valuable insights into search volume, competition, and related keywords, helping you identify high-value terms aligned with your target audience’s intent.
Beyond these tools, consider incorporating long-tail keywords – longer, more specific phrases that offer lower competition but often convert better. Analyzing competitor websites and industry trends can also yield fruitful keyword ideas. By combining these approaches, you’ll have a robust list of keywords ready for optimization in your content strategy, ensuring your website resonates with relevant search queries.

Off-Page Strategies: Link Building and Keyword Authority
Off-page SEO strategies, particularly link building and keyword authority, play a pivotal role in enhancing your website’s visibility and search engine rankings. Keyword research and optimization are fundamental to this process. By identifying relevant keywords that your target audience is actively searching for, you can create valuable content that naturally incorporates these terms. This not only attracts backlinks from reputable sources but also establishes your site as an authority within the domain.
Link building involves acquiring high-quality inbound links from other websites, which signals to search engines that your content is trustworthy and worthy of a higher ranking. Keyword authority refers to the strength of these links and their relevance to your chosen keywords. Effective link-building strategies include guest blogging, influencer collaborations, and creating shareable resources that naturally attract backlinks. Ensuring that these links are coming from sites with high domain authority and relevant traffic will significantly boost your own keyword rankings and overall SEO performance.
Monitoring and Refining Your Keyword Strategy
Regular monitoring is key to understanding how your keyword strategy performs over time, allowing for continuous refinement and optimization. Tools like Google Search Console and Analytics provide valuable insights into search trends, user behavior, and the effectiveness of your target keywords. By analyzing these data points, you can identify high-performing keywords that drive organic traffic and those that need improvement or replacement.
Refining involves updating your keyword list based on new market trends, user preferences, and search engine algorithm updates. It’s a dynamic process that requires staying abreast of industry developments and adjusting your content strategy accordingly. Regularly review less performant keywords for opportunities to incorporate more relevant terms or phrases, ensuring your content remains optimized for current search intent.
